3D AI Secure Door Lock Complements Smart Room Control

The atxx Smart Room Control series features a compact 55×55 mm DIN-frame touchscreen that centralizes lighting, climate, blinds, audio and emergency lighting management in a single unit. Its intuitive interface lets users adjust temperature and illumination with a few taps or integrate schedules and presets. Complementing this solution, the atxx AI Secure Door Lock uses advanced 3D face recognition to grant or deny access, delivering heightened security for hotels and corporate facilities.

E-Paper Meeting Room Sign Offers Real-Time Occupancy And Information

The _atxx E-Paper Meeting Room Display and the _atxx Meeting Room/Table Information Sign offer energy-efficient, low-power electronic ink screens that deliver real-time occupancy data and scheduling details at room entrances. These devices maintain visibility under diverse lighting conditions without emitting glare. Intuitive interface enables seamless updates via connected network systems, reducing manual adjustments. By integrating automated status changes and calendar synchronization, they enhance meeting space utilization and streamline facility management.

atxx 3D Occupancy Security Detection Provides Real-Time Room Insights

The atxx 3D occupancy and security detection module provides real-time spatial occupancy metrics and behavioral analysis using depth sensing and analytics. It streams localized data to edge processors, delivering immediate alerts for unauthorized movement or loitering. An integrated edge-AI fire and smoke detection algorithm rapidly recognizes early flame signatures and smoke particulates, operating effectively indoors and outdoors. This unified solution ensures proactive threat identification and situational awareness with minimal latency.

Bel SS-69000-001 SPE Connector Enables Space-Saving Building Automation Solutions

For space-saving building automation setups, the Bel SS-69000-001 Single Pair Ethernet jack (IEC 63171-1) streamlines network cabling by combining data and power over a single twisted pair. Managed Gigabit Ethernet PoE++ switches from Lantronix (SM24TBT4XPA and SM24TBT2DPB) deliver high-power throughput and granular traffic control for bandwidth-intensive smart building applications. Complementing these components, the Qualcomm Technologies QCC744 module offers integrated Wi-Fi 6, Bluetooth 5.4 and IEEE 802.15.4 connectivity. It enhances flexibility.
